Output bb020fb18336b405606e95c63c2c654126afade95f23afd2ad2441217cc8a785:2

value
135585
script pubkey
OP_0 OP_PUSHBYTES_20 ff0fbbd8ced7656354e0e3563c1522d9b3c94f32
address
bc1qlu8mhkxw6ajkx48qudtrc9fzmxeujnejsk45wd
transaction
bb020fb18336b405606e95c63c2c654126afade95f23afd2ad2441217cc8a785
confirmations
175697
spent
true